Scientific Computation Research Group projects


In the Scientific Computation group we are working on a wide variety of projects concerning the computational solution of Partial Differential Equations. These are a mixture of research council funded PhD and post-doctoral research projects and industrially funded consultancy work. Often this work involves collaboration with other departments within the University of Leeds, with research groups from other universities, both UK and abroad, and with industrial partners through consultancy contracts or student research funding through EPSRC CASE Awards.
